Short History of Brislington Brislington is known to have been occupied in Roman times due to the fact that the remains of a Roman vacation home dating from around AD 270-300 were found when Winchester Road was being constructed in1899. The rental property was most likely the centre of a large estate and is believed to have actually been destroyed by fire concerning advertisement 367, probably after a raid by Irish pirates.


Originally it was offered by the Augustinian canons from Keynsham Abbey which was started in concerning 1166. The here and now church dates from 1420 and was constructed by the 5th Baron Thomas la Warr. The family members (later the de la Warrs) were the lords of the estate from the late 12th Century to the late 16th Century; they were to give their name to the state of Delaware in the U.S.A..

In middle ages times Brislington became a popular location of expedition, measuring up to Walsingham and Canterbury. In around 1276 Roger la Warr started the Church of St Anne-in- the-Wood near a divine well, which was stated to have healing powers. The chapel was twice gone to by Henry VII, in 1486 and again in 1502 accompanied by his queen, Elizabeth of York.

Brislington had 2 mansion homes. The middle ages moated and fortified mansion home of the de la Warrs stood in West Town Lane.




The second, the Arno's Team of structures, (consisting of 'The Black Castle') was developed by William Reeve, a rich eccentric Quaker copper smelter. In 1850 the residence became a Roman Catholic convent and lady's reformatory school, remaining so up until 1948. brislington bristol park and ride.

Brislington is two miles south-east of Bristol city centre and was called one of the most beautiful villages in Somerset in the very early 19th century. Wick House, integrated in circa 1790, was a rental property that stood in sixty acres of satisfaction premises.

Many major sector enclosed the 1980s, and virtually all of the initial buildings have actually currently been destroyed. Brislington was still quite a rural, semi-agricultural neighborhood until well right into 20th Century. At the turn of the century there were sixteen main working ranches in the village and numerous small-holdings, along with market yards.
